The 2018 4 Hours of Fuji was the second round of the 2018-19 Asian Le Mans Series season. It took place on December 9, 2018, at Fuji Speedway in Oyama, Shizuoka, Japan.[1]

Qualifying results

Pole positions in each class are indicated in bold.

Pos. Class No. Entry Chassis Time
1 LMP2 22 United States United Autosports Ligier JS P2-Nissan 1:31.685
2 LMP2 24 Portugal Algarve Pro Racing Ligier JS P2-Judd 1:32.020
3 LMP2 8 Switzerland Spirit of Race Ligier JS P2-Nissan 1:32.154
4 LMP2 23 United States United Autosports Ligier JS P2-Nissan 1:32.885
5 LMP2 25 Portugal Algarve Pro Racing Ligier JS P2-Judd 1:33.028
6 LMP2 4 Slovakia ARC Bratislava Ligier JS P2-Nissan 1:33.098
7 LMP2 35 France Panis Barthez Competition Ligier JS P2-Judd 1:34.751
8 LMP3 65 Malaysia Viper Niza Racing Ligier JS P3 1:35.467
9 LMP3 2 United States United Autosports Ligier JS P3 1:36.095
10 LMP3 3 United States United Autosports Ligier JS P3 1:36.152
11 LMP3 36 Philippines Eurasia Motorsport Ligier JS P3 1:36.551
12 LMP3 13 Poland Inter Europol Competition Ligier JS P3 1:36.836
13 LMP3 7 United Kingdom Ecurie Ecosse/Nielsen Ligier JS P3 1:36.838
14 GT 11 Japan CarGuy Racing Ferrari 488 GT3 1:37.852
15 GT 51 Switzerland Spirit of Race Ferrari 488 GT3 1:38.236
16 GT 88 China Audi Sport Customer Racing Asia by TSRT Audi R8 LMS 1:38.774
17 GT 66 China Audi Sport Customer Racing Asia by TSRT Audi R8 LMS 1:39.659
18 GT 5 United Kingdom Red River Sport by TF Sport Aston Martin V12 Vantage GT3 1:45.266
19 LMP3 50 Japan R24 Ligier JS P3 1:52.964
20 LMP3 79 United Kingdom Ecurie Ecosse/Nielsen Ligier JS P3
